The Greatist Recordings of All Time

#59-"Ride of the Valkaries"
by Richard Wagner
performed by "United States Marine Band"

From Wagner's epic four cycle Opera -The Ring-"Valkaries" is a stunning
and instantly recognizable piece of classical music.While during his lifetime Wagner had his
share of detractors;his music was quite differant from that of his contemperaries so it's
understandable that for some-Wagner's Horn and Woodwind drivin' compositions were
not everyone's cup of tea.
Of coarse now Wagner is fully accepted as one of classical music's greatist composer's.
As bombastic as some of his music can be you can't deny that there is a very strong and
emotionally charged sense to it."Flight of the Valkaries" is a perfect example.It instantly
grab's your attention.When it was used in the film "Apocalypse Now" it became exposed
to a new and much larger audience.Wagner was a follower of Frans Listz and he even
married one of Listz's daughters.People who only know "Valkaries" from it's use in
"Apocalypse Now" may not know who Richard Wagner is but that doesn't stop them from,
being tremendously moved by his music.
